Key Considerations Before Buying
- Thickness and durability: Look for a plastic sheeting thickness (often measured in mils) that can withstand foot traffic and accidental spills without tearing. A thicker material, like 1.0 mil or more, provides better protection for heavy-duty use.
- Size and coverage: A 9x12 ft sheet is ideal for covering a standard room's floor or a large sofa, but ensure the 30-pack quantity matches the scale of your project. For multiple rooms or extensive furniture protection, this bulk pack offers good value.
- Versatility: Consider if the plastic is suitable for both indoor and outdoor use, and whether it can be used for dust-proofing during renovations or as a temporary cover for outdoor furniture. This product's tear-resistant claim suggests it can handle various tasks beyond painting.

Common Issues
Common issues with plastic drop cloths include tearing under stress, slipping on smooth floors, and being too thin to prevent paint bleed-through. Some users also report that the plastic can be noisy or static-prone, which can be annoying during use. Additionally, environmental concerns about single-use plastics are prompting some to seek more sustainable alternatives.
Quality Indicators
To identify quality in this category, look for products with a mil thickness of at least 0.7-1.0 for general use, and check for reinforced seams or hems. Comparing Alternatives
Shoppers should compare this product with canvas drop cloths for reusability and better floor grip, or with thicker plastic sheeting (e.g., 2 mil or more) for industrial-grade protection. Other bulk packs may offer different sizes or thicknesses, so review the specifications carefully.
